Inhibition of vascular calcium-gated chloride currents by blockers of K(Ca)1.1, but not by modulators of K(Ca)2.1 or K(Ca)2.3 channels
B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E: Recent pharmacological studies have proposed there is a high degree of similarity between calcium-activated Cl(−) channels (CaCCs) and large conductance, calcium-gated K(+) channels (K(Ca)1.1).
